The question is related to trigonometric ratio rule .

In the given diagram, there is a right angle triangle, with adjacent =57, and the unknown side is y. Given angle measurement is 39 .

To find the measurement of y, we will use tan rule which is

[tex] tan \Theta = \frac{opposite}{adjacent} [/tex]

[tex] tan 39=\frac{y}{57} [/tex]

y = 57 tan 39 = 46.2
